Any other murder case, with a person’s sperm being found on the deceased clothes, would make that person a ‘suspect’ or at least a person of interest. Not in this case. Stephen Kelly could not explain how his sperm was on Jodi’s T-shirt, so the police gave him the explanation that was required. Jodi must have borrowed her sister’s T-shirt, and the ‘investigation’ into Stephen Kelly was concluded. The problem with that theory is that Janine and Jodi lived in different houses and she would not have had access to the t-shirt. Corrinne Mitchell was asked three specific questions of which she was not made aware prior to them being asked: James Falconer, the “condom man” was not questioned by police until three years after the murder despite his DNA being on a condom meters away from where Jodi’s body was found. He claimed to have been in the woods at approximately 9 p.m. having a “clean wank,” 15 meters away from where the mutilated body of Jodi Jones was lying. Mitchell discovered Jodi’s body, which was hidden behind a wall on the path, after claiming his dog led him to the scent, Family members with him said he appeared to know where the body was. This contradicted his evidence the dog had led them to the wall. He also showed no emotion at the horrifying sight. Corinne Mitchell was arrested on the same day, April 14th, 2004, and also charged with perverting the course of justice. These charges were later spread all over the media, however the charges never materialised (like her son, Shane, the charges were later dropped). When giving evidence, it is common practice for most witnesses in a High Court trial to be warned about the risks and penalty for perjury. This was true for Corinne Mitchell as well.
